Between a rock and a hard place: Environmental and engineering considerations when designing coastal defence structures
Louise B. Firth,Richard C. Thompson,Katrin Bohn,Marco Abbiati,Laura Airoldi,Tjeerd J. Bouma,Fabio Bozzeda,Victor Ugo Ceccherelli,Marina Antonia Colangelo,Ally J. Evans,Filippo Ferrario,Mick E. Hanley,Hilmar Hinz,Simon P. G. Hoggart,Juliette Jackson,Pippa J. Moore,E. H. Morgan,Shimrit Perkol-Finkel,Martin W. Skov,Elisabeth M. A. Strain,J. van Belzen,Stephen J. Hawkins +21 more
TL;DR: In this article, the authors review the major impacts coastal defence structures have on surrounding environments and recent experiments informing building coastal defences in a more ecologically sustainable manner, and outline guidelines and recommendations to provide multiple ecosystem services while maintaining engineering efficacy.

Shifting sands? Coastal protection by sand banks, beaches and dunes
Mick E. Hanley,Simon P. G. Hoggart,David Simmonds,Amandine Bichot,Marina Antonia Colangelo,Fabio Bozzeda,H. Heurtefeux,Bárbara Ondiviela,Rafał Ostrowski,M. Recio,R. Trude,E. Zawadzka-Kahlau,Richard C. Thompson +12 more
TL;DR: In this article, the authors investigated the critical drivers that determine the persistence and maintenance of sandy coastal habitats around Europe's coastline, taking particular interest in their close link with the biological communities that inhabit them.

THESEUS decision support system for coastal risk management
Barbara Zanuttigh,Dario Simcic,Stefano Bagli,Fabio Bozzeda,Luca Pietrantoni,Fabio Zagonari,Simon P. G. Hoggart,Robert J. Nicholls +7 more
TL;DR: The exploratory tool allows the users to perform an integrated coastal risk assessment, to analyse the effects of different combinations of engineering, social, economic and ecologically based mitigation options, across short, medium and long-term scenarios.

Dynamics of plastic resin pellets deposition on a microtidal sandy beach: Informative variables and potential integration into sandy beach studies
Lucia Fanini,Fabio Bozzeda +1 more
TL;DR: In this article, the authors studied the temporal dynamics of plastic resin pellets input on a Mediterranean beach, paired with standard environmental variables known to be relevant to sandy beach ecology, such as the main wind direction and strength, and seasonal substrate mean grain size estimates.
